Electrolytes: Energy Support, Not a Stimulant
At its core, an electrolyte powder contains essential minerals like sodium, potassium, and magnesium that carry an electric charge when dissolved in water. These minerals are vital for countless bodily functions, including regulating fluid balance, controlling muscle contractions, and transmitting nerve signals.
Electrolytes do not provide an energy rush in the same way that caffeine or sugar does. Instead, they support the body's natural energy production process. They assist in the synthesis of ATP (adenosine triphosphate), the molecule cells use for energy, by helping transport nutrients and conduct electrical currents in the nervous system. When your electrolyte levels are balanced, your body functions optimally, helping to prevent fatigue. This feels like an energy boost, but it is not the result of a stimulating effect that will keep you awake.
The Real Culprits: Hidden Stimulants and Sugars
If you find yourself awake after consuming an electrolyte powder, the cause is likely not the minerals themselves. Many commercial electrolyte products are formulated for specific purposes, and some contain additives that can disrupt sleep:
- Caffeine and other stimulants: Some powders add caffeine or other natural stimulants like guarana to market the product as an "energy" drink. Always check the ingredient list to ensure it is stimulant-free, especially if you plan to consume it in the evening.
 - High sugar content: Many traditional sports drinks and some electrolyte mixes contain high amounts of sugar (carbohydrates). A sudden spike in blood sugar can provide a jolt of energy, followed by a crash, which can destabilize energy levels and interfere with a calm, sleep-ready state. Choosing a sugar-free or low-sugar option can prevent this issue.
 - Fluid overload before bed: Regardless of the drink's contents, consuming a large volume of liquid right before sleep can lead to nocturia, the need to wake up and urinate during the night. This mechanical disruption of your sleep cycle can leave you feeling restless and awake.
 
The Dual Role of Electrolytes in Sleep
While certain additives can hinder sleep, a balanced electrolyte intake can actually support a more restful night. The key lies in understanding the specific function of different minerals.
How an Imbalance Disrupts Rest
When your electrolyte levels are out of balance, your body's systems can be affected in ways that disrupt sleep.
- Muscle cramps: Inadequate levels of minerals like magnesium and potassium are often linked to painful muscle cramps and restless legs, which can be jolting enough to wake you up.
 - Stress and anxiety: Proper hydration, maintained by electrolytes, helps keep cortisol (the stress hormone) levels in check. An imbalance can heighten anxiety and restlessness, making it harder to fall asleep.
 - General fatigue: Dehydration caused by an electrolyte imbalance can lead to fatigue, headaches, and weakness, all of which contribute to a feeling of being unwell and can interfere with sleep quality.
 
How Proper Balance Promotes Better Sleep
Conversely, when your electrolytes are balanced, they can help create a state of calm conducive to sleep.
- Magnesium: This mineral is a major sleep aid. It helps relax muscles, calms the nervous system by regulating neurotransmitters like GABA, and aids in the production of melatonin, the sleep hormone.
 - Potassium: Working with magnesium, potassium helps regulate nerve signals and muscle contractions, preventing cramps that might disturb your rest.
 - Calcium: Studies have shown that calcium plays a role in regulating slow-wave or deep sleep, helping to promote a more restorative night.
 
Choosing an Electrolyte Powder for Nighttime Hydration
To ensure your electrolyte powder supports, rather than hinders, your sleep, pay close attention to the formula. A good nighttime mix will have a different profile than a daytime energy or intense workout formula.
| Feature | Nighttime-Friendly Electrolyte Powder | Energy-Focused Electrolyte Powder | 
|---|---|---|
| Stimulants | No caffeine, guarana, or other stimulants. | Contains caffeine, sometimes from sources like green tea extract. | 
| Sugar | Low or no sugar. Often sweetened with natural alternatives like stevia or monk fruit. | May contain high levels of sugar (carbohydrates) for a quick energy boost. | 
| Key Minerals | Higher concentration of magnesium and potassium to promote relaxation. | Higher concentration of sodium to replenish heavy sweat loss. | 
| Best Use | Rehydrating overnight, calming nerves, and preventing nighttime muscle cramps. | Fueling high-intensity, prolonged workouts or boosting energy and focus. | 
When selecting a powder for evening use, scrutinize the label. Look for a clean, natural ingredient list with an emphasis on magnesium and potassium, and ensure there are no added stimulants or excessive sugar.
Timing is Everything: Preventing Sleep Interruption
To maximize the benefits of nighttime hydration without interrupting sleep, strategic timing is crucial. Rather than chugging a large drink right before bed, taper your fluid intake in the two hours leading up to sleep. A small glass of an electrolyte mix consumed 90 minutes before bedtime can help your body absorb and retain the fluid more efficiently, minimizing the need for late-night bathroom trips while still providing the minerals needed for rest and recovery.
